  1. When capturing at 640*480, Huffav yield around 800M/s, which is about 48G/hr. I tried LEAD MJPEG, Lossless codec works even worse. I only have a 60G HD. So I need a codec which still treat every frame as keyframe but yields <40G/hr. It will be better <30G/hr. It will be even better that it can be encode later to SVCD,VCD and DivX quicker.

    BTW: It seems impossible to keep "loseless", but I want to keep the most quality with the size restriction :P

  2. I used the DV codec (MainConcept) to obtain good quality and easy editing, because not having a DVD burner, I store the master version on a DV tape.
    In this way the editing is very fast and the size is the usual 13 Gb/hr.
    To obtain this i had to change processor up to Athlon 1.2 GHz.
    Also check the field order because I had to change it in the codec, coming from Hi8 tapes.
